CAT5126VP2I10GT3 Overview
The CAT5126VP2I10GT3 is a high-performance digital potentiometer designed for precise resistance adjustment in electronic applications. It offers a combination of flexibility and reliability, making it ideal for a range of industrial uses. With its advanced features and robust design, this component enhances circuit performance and simplifies integration into various systems. CAT5126VP2I10GT3 Technical Specifications
| 参数 | 价值 |
|---|---|
| Resistance Range | 10k?? to 100k?? |
| 电源电压 | 2.7V 至 5.5V |
| 通道数 | 4 |
| 决议 | 8 bits |
| 工作温度范围 | -40°C 至 +85°C |
| 包装类型 | TSSOP |
| 界面 | I2C |
| 功率耗散 | 50 毫瓦 |
